Wagering Calculation
Understanding wagering requirements is crucial to avoid disappointment when you want to withdraw bonus winnings. Wagering means you must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it plus bonus) a certain number of times before your winnings become withdrawable.
Here is a typical example. Suppose you deposit £50 and receive a 100% match bonus of £50, so your total bonus funds are £50. If the wagering requirement is 30x the bonus amount, then the formula is:
Wagering requirement = Bonus amount × Wagering multiplier
Plugging in the numbers:
£50 × 30 = £1,500
So you must place bets totalling £1,500 before you can withdraw any winnings that came from the bonus. But be careful: some casinos require wagering on the deposit plus bonus. In that case, the calculation changes:
(Deposit + Bonus) × Multiplier = (£50 + £50) × 30 = £100 × 30 = £3,000
Now you must wager £3,000. Always check the terms to see which basis applies.
Also, not all games contribute equally to wagering. Typically, slots contribute 100%, table games often contribute only 10% or 20%, and live dealer games may contribute 0%. For example, if you play blackjack with a 10% contribution rate, a £10 bet only counts as £1 towards your wagering requirement. If slots contribute 100%, then £10 counts as £10.
Security
Your safety online is non-negotiable. The casino uses SSL encryption to protect data transmission between your browser and the server. This ensures that passwords, payment details, and personal information cannot be intercepted. Always look for the padlock icon in the address bar.
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security. Even if someone steals your password, they cannot log in without your mobile device. We strongly recommend enabling 2FA immediately after registration.
Responsible gambling tools are part of the security ecosystem. Deposit limits, session reminders, and self-exclusion are available in the responsible gambling section of your account. Use them if you feel your gambling is becoming problematic.
Be wary of phishing emails pretending to be from the casino. Always type the official web address manually or use a bookmark. Never click links in suspicious emails or messages.
If you are a player in an EU or Nordic country and the casino holds a Curacao license, remember that winnings may be subject to local income tax, depending on your country’s tax laws. Unlike MGA or local licenses, Curacao licenses do not guarantee tax-free winnings. Check with a local tax advisor to avoid surprises.

Common Problems & Fixes
Even with a smooth casino, occasional issues pop up. Here are five common scenarios and how to resolve them.
Scenario 1: I forgot my password. Click the “Forgot Password” link on the login page. Enter your registered email address, and you will receive a reset link. Follow the instructions to create a new password. If the email does not arrive, check your spam folder or wait a few minutes and try again.
Scenario 2: My withdrawal is pending for more than 48 hours. First, check your account for any unverified documents. If your KYC is incomplete, finish it immediately. Sometimes withdrawals take longer due to weekends or public holidays. If it still exceeds the stated time, contact customer support via live chat or email and provide your account ID.
Scenario 3: The game keeps freezing or crashing. This is usually a browser or internet issue. Clear your browser cache and cookies, disable any ad blockers, and update your browser to the latest version. If you use the mobile PWA, try closing tabs or restarting the browser. A stable Wi-Fi connection is recommended.
Scenario 4: I cannot withdraw because my wagering requirement is not met. Open the bonus section to see your wagering progress. If you are playing a game with a 100% contribution rate, your bets count fully. If you played table games, your contribution might be lower, so switch to slots to meet the requirement faster.
Scenario 5: I did not receive my bonus code. Double-check the code for typos and ensure you entered it during sign-up. Some bonuses require opting in from the promotions page before deposit. If the code is valid, contact support with the code name and your account email.
Extra Tips
Responsible gambling is a priority at twinvegas. The casino provides tools to help you stay in control.
- Deposit limits: Set a maximum amount you can deposit per day, week, or month. You can adjust these limits in the responsible gambling section, but they are designed to be binding for a certain period.
- Session limits: You can set a time limit for your gaming sessions. Once you reach it, you will be logged out automatically.
- Self-exclusion: If you need a longer break, you can exclude yourself from the casino for a period of 24 hours, 1 week, 1 month, or even permanently. This is irreversible during the exclusion period.
Always use these tools proactively. They are there to protect you, not to restrict your fun.
